Greg Kefer and Richard Barnett discuss a recent Boston Consulting Group article on digital disruption in this podcast. Using the example of Amazon, BCG describes how three different waves of digital disruption have changed businesses and brought on a convergence of new capabilities. This provides a broader strategic map for how to orchestrate data with the broader supply chain to achieve new levels of agility, responsiveness, and time to market.
